Try Traditional Goan Cuisine
If you visit Goa and don’t try local food, you’ll miss the taste of wow. Xacuti, caffreal, vegetarian, recheado, fish curry, and prawn preparations are traditional Goan foods. If you have special preferences than can discuss them before ordering.
Explore Fontainhas After Dinner
Fontainhas in Panjim is one of the most popular heritage. The Portuguese-style buildings, attractive architecture, and narrow streets make evening exploration more picturesque. The local areas for a relaxed walk help to connect with Goa’s history.
